Understanding Dog’s Anxiety and Stress

Dogs are the beloved companions of many pet owners, and just like humans, they experience stress and anxiety. Understanding these emotions and how they affect your furry friend’s behavior and health is crucial for its well-being and for creating a harmonious environment. 

Dogs can be stressed and anxious due to the following reasons:

  • Separation from their owners or any close family member.
  • Changes in routine or environment.
  • Loud noises like fireworks or thunderstorms.
  • Medical conditions or chronic pain.
  • Car travel.

You can know whether your dog is anxious through excessive panting, barking, restlessness, destructive chewing, or withdrawal. In addition, if not treated on time, chronic stress can significantly weaken your pet’s immune system, leading to various health issues.

Introducing CBD Oil for Stressed Dogs

CBD, or cannabidiol, is a natural cannabis compound that interacts with the endocannabinoid system (ECS) in both humans and dogs. The ECS system regulates multiple physiological processes, such as stress response, mood, digestion, and pain perception. 

Below are some potential benefits of CBD pet treats for dogs dealing with stress and anxiety:

  • Calming effects: CBD is famous for its calming effects; thus, giving it to your dog can make it feel more relaxed and less anxious. The compound can help reduce the physiological responses associated with stress and anxiety, such as an elevated heart rate.
  • Reduces fear-based behavior: CBD can provide a sense of relaxation to your dog and, thus, might alleviate fear-related behaviors such as trembling, excessive barking, or hiding during loud noises.
  • Improves sleep: Falling asleep might be difficult when your four-legged friend suffers from stress or anxiety. CBD is researched to promote better sleep patterns, helping your companion rest more comfortably.
  • Pain management: Chronic pain can be among the significant causes of stress for dogs. CBD’s anti-inflammatory properties might reduce inflammation-caused pain and, thus, reduce stress, improving your dog’s overall well-being.
  • Support for aggressive behavior: Some stressed or anxious dogs might exhibit aggressive behavior. Regularly giving CBD to your anxious dog can reduce aggression by calming its nerves.

The Science Behind CBD for Dogs 

  • A clinical trial at Colorado State University researched how hemp-derived cannabidiol (CBD) products can impact dogs suffering from chronic pain caused by osteoarthritis. According to the study, adding full-spectrum, hemp-derived CBD oil decreased pain scores and improved mobility and overall quality of life for 94% of dogs participating in the clinical trial. Since chronic pain can make your dog stressed or anxious, relieving it with CBD can help your dog overcome their stress.
  • Researchers at Mars Incorporated discovered that dogs treated with CBD were significantly less sad, had lower cortisol levels, and were more relaxed than dogs treated with a placebo. 

Does CBD Make Your Dog High?

There is a significant difference between the two strains of CBD. CBD supplements for pets extracted from industrial hemp plants usually have high levels of CBD and virtually no THC. Conversely, CBD oil extracted from marijuana often has little quantity of CBD and a high quantity of THC, making your dog feel high. CBD extracted from industrial hemp is legalized in the US, but marijuana is highly regulated even in the states that legalize the use of marijuana for medical and recreational purposes.

You should know the difference between these two CBD strains to protect your dog against the toxicity of THC. Now that CBD doesn’t make humans and dogs high, it’s safe for your furry friend. It will be best to look for CBD pet drops containing 0.3% THC or less to calm your dog without making it feel high. 

How Do You Choose the Right CBD Product for Your Anxious Dog?

CBD advertising and labeling can be confusing and sometimes misleading. So, to find the right CBD product for your anxious dog, you must shop carefully. Consider the below-discussed factors to choose the best CBD pet drops for your furry companion:

  • Full-spectrum vs. broad-spectrum vs. isolate: Full-spectrum CBD contains all the compounds, flavonoids, and terpenes found in cannabis plants. Pet products made of full-spectrum CBD also contain THC and, thus, are ideal if you want to produce an entourage effect for your dog. Broad-spectrum CBD products contain all cannabis compounds except THC, making them safe for your dog’s consumption. Lastly, CBD isolate products contain only CBD.
  • Third-party testing: You should check whether CBD products for dogs have undergone third-party testing for potency and purity. It will ensure you give your four-legged companion a safe and effective product.
  • Dosage: It’s advisable to talk to your dog’s veterinarian to know the correct dosage for your pet based on its size, weight, and specific needs. It will help if you look for CBD products based on your canine companion’s dosage requirements.
  • Administration: You can find CBD oil for dogs in various forms, such as treats, tinctures, and capsules. It’s recommended that you choose the administration form that is most convenient for your dog.
